Dualog Identity - Ship-Side Identity Server

INTRODUCTION

Dualog Identity provides authentication services both in the cloud and on vessels. While cloud authentication is handled by the identity server at crew.dualog.com, ship-side authentication requires a local identity server running on the vessel.

The ship-side identity server is a component of Dualog Connection Suite. It enables:

  • Single Sign-On (SSO) for applications running on the vessel
  • Active Directory provisioning for Windows domains onboard

WHY A LOCAL IDENTITY SERVER?

Vessels frequently operate with limited or no internet connectivity. The ship-side identity server ensures that:

  • Crew can always authenticate to onboard applications, regardless of connectivity
  • Authentication is fast (no dependency on satellite links)
  • Security policies are enforced locally

When the vessel has connectivity, the ship-side identity server automatically syncs with the cloud within minutes, receiving:

  • New and updated user accounts
  • Ship assignments and access policies
  • Integration configurations
  • Password policy settings

PREREQUISITES

To use ship-side identity features (OIDC integrations or Active Directory provisioning), you need:

  1. A vessel created in the Dualog Portal - The vessel must be set up in your organization with its IMO number configured
  2. Dualog Connection Suite installed on the vessel - The Connection Suite platform includes the ship-side identity server
  3. The vessel bound to your organization - Done via the Startpack during installation

SETTING UP THE SHIP-SIDE IDENTITY SERVER

The ship-side identity server is automatically included when you install Dualog Connection Suite. Follow these steps:

Step 1: Create the Vessel

Before installing Connection Suite, the vessel must be created in the Dualog Portal:

  1. Log in to https://apps.dualog.com
  2. Go to Organization > Ships
  3. Click Add ship and follow the setup wizard

For detailed instructions, see Connection Suite Vessel Creation.

Step 2: Download the Startpack

The Startpack contains the vessel's configuration and binds the installation to your organization:

  1. In the Dualog Portal, go to Connection Suite > CS Ship Setup
  2. Select your vessel
  3. Download the Startpack (.dsp file) matching your Connection Suite version

For detailed instructions, see How to download Startpack.

Step 3: Install Dualog Connection Suite

Install Connection Suite on the vessel's Dualog PC:

  1. Run the Connection Suite installer
  2. Follow the installation wizard
  3. When prompted, provide the Startpack file you downloaded
  4. Complete the installation and reboot

For detailed instructions, see Dualog Connection Suite - Full Installation.

Step 4: Configure Ship-Side Integrations

Once Connection Suite is installed:

  • Ship-side OIDC integrations configured in the Dualog Portal will automatically sync to the vessel
  • Active Directory integrations will begin provisioning users to the ship's AD
  • Users assigned to the vessel will be able to authenticate locally

SYNC BEHAVIOR

The ship-side identity server syncs with the cloud automatically:

  • Frequency: Within minutes when the vessel has connectivity
  • Offline operation: The server continues to work fully offline using the last synced data
  • Automatic updates: Configuration changes made in the Dualog Portal are pushed to vessels automatically

TROUBLESHOOTING

Ship-side integrations not working

  • Verify Dualog Connection Suite is installed and running on the vessel
  • Check that the vessel was created with the correct IMO number
  • Verify the vessel has had connectivity to sync the latest configuration

Users cannot authenticate on the vessel

  • Confirm the user is assigned to that specific vessel (check ship assignment in Crew Accounts)
  • Verify the user's contract dates are current
  • Check that the user's account is active

Configuration changes not appearing on vessel

  • Changes sync within minutes when connected
  • If the vessel is offline, changes will sync when connectivity is restored
  • Contact Dualog support if sync issues persist
